FAO concept/definition of FAMILY FARMING:

1. It’s very diificult to define FFs: there were

find out more than 36 definitions: 13 Latin American family farms;

7 refere to Sub-Saharan family farms.

2. The International Steering Committee for IYFF:

Family Farming (which includes all family-based agricultural

activities) is a means of organizing agricultural, forestry,

fisheries, pastoral and aquaculture production which is

managed and operated by a family and predominantly

reliant on family labour, including both women’s and

men’s. The family and the farm are linked, co-evolve and

combine economic, environmental, social and cultural

functions

What is, then, a Family Farmer in Brazil ?

By Law 11.326, 2006

① do not have, in any way, an area bigger than 4 inspection units

– different size per regions in the country;

② use predominantly family labour force in the farmers unit –

also wage labour up to 2 permanent works;

③ have a minimum % of family income originating from the

economic activities of the establishment or venture;

④the farmer unit must be lead by the family and not by external

managers;

This Law also applies to fisherman, forestry, small cattle ranchers, indigenous people,

traditional communities (former slaves/quilombos)

Family Farming in Latin America – REAF, FAO and others

there are four main elements that define a family farmer:

(a) family labor is predominant in the production process and alleconomic activities which are the family livelihood;

(b) the family controls the management of the farmunit/agricultural establishment;

(c) The production outputs and other non agricultural incomesources belong to and are manage by the family; and

(d) access to the means of production (land, etc) is generallycarried out by inheritance.

① Definir el objetivo de la tipología;

② Formular una hipótesis sobre la diversidad de sistemas

agrícolas;

③ Seleccionar las variables que caracterizan los sistemas;

④ Diseñar un método de muestreo para la recolección de

datos;

⑤ Agrupar/clasificar los sistemas a través de la

estadística multivariada;

⑥ Comparar los resultados con la hipótesis inicial y

validar la tipología con especialistas locales

Paso-a-paso para hacer un tipologia

Fuente: Álvarez et alii (2014)

Inter-American Committee for Agricultural Development (CIDA, 1966)

1) Sub-family farms - do not have sufficient land to meet the minimum needs

of one family, and they allow for the use the labor of two families during the entire year;

2) Family farms – have enough land to support a family within an adequate

standard of living, involving the labor of two to four family members and by using typical methods of the region;

3) Medium or multi-family estates – possess enough land to employ a

certain number of workers (4 to 12) in addition to the family, but does not warrant a larger organization composed of a manager, administrator or other employees;

4) Large estates (latifundia) - Possess enough land to be able to give

permanent employment to a much larger group of workers than the owner's family (more than 12 workers), having to divide the work and establishing an administrative hierarchy.

World Bank (2008):

1) Market-oriented small farmers - who derive most of their

income from participation in agricultural markets;

2) Subsistence farmers - depend on agriculture for their

livelihood, but use most of the production for household

consumption;

3) Work-oriented families - obtain most of their income from

salary labor in agriculture, non-farm activities and self-

employment in agriculture;

4) Migrating families - choose to leave the rural areas or

depend entirely on monetary transfers from family

members that migrated;

5) Mixed family households - combine agricultural and non-

agricultural incomes and remittances from those who have

migrated.
